/*
* Copyright (c) 2021 The ZMK Contributors
*
* SPDX-License-Identifier: MIT
*/
#include "glove80.dtsi"
#include "glove80_lh-pinctrl.dtsi"
#include <dt-bindings/led/led.h>
/ {
model = "glove80_lh";
compatible = "glove80_lh";
chosen {
zmk,underglow = &led_strip;
zmk,backlight = &back_led_backlight;
zmk,battery = &vbatt;
};
back_led_backlight: pwmleds {
compatible = "pwm-leds";
label = "BACK LED";
pwm_led_0 {
pwms = <&pwm0 0 PWM_USEC(20) PWM_POLARITY_NORMAL>;
label = "Back LED configured as backlight";
};
};
ext-power {
compatible = "zmk,ext-power-generic";
label = "EXT_POWER";
control-gpios = <&gpio0 31 GPIO_ACTIVE_HIGH>; /* WS2812_CE */
init-delay-ms = <100>;
};
vbatt: vbatt {
compatible = "zmk,battery-nrf-vddh";
label = "BATTERY";
};
};
&spi3 {
compatible = "nordic,nrf-spim";
status = "okay";
pinctrl-0 = <&spi3_default>;
pinctrl-1 = <&spi3_sleep>;
pinctrl-names = "default", "sleep";
led_strip: ws2812@0 {
compatible = "worldsemi,ws2812-spi";
label = "WS2812C-2020";
/* SPI */
reg = <0>; /* ignored, but necessary for SPI bindings */
spi-max-frequency = <4000000>;
/* WS2812 */
chain-length = <40>; /* 40 keys have underglow at the moment */
spi-one-frame = <0x70>;
spi-zero-frame = <0x40>;
color-mapping = <LED_COLOR_ID_GREEN LED_COLOR_ID_RED LED_COLOR_ID_BLUE>;
};
};
&pwm0 {
status = "okay";
pinctrl-0 = <&pwm0_default>;
pinctrl-1 = <&pwm0_sleep>;
pinctrl-names = "default", "sleep";
};
&uart0 {
compatible = "nordic,nrf-uarte";
pinctrl-0 = <&uart0_default>;
pinctrl-1 = <&uart0_sleep>;
pinctrl-names = "default", "sleep";
};
&kscan0 {
row-gpios
= <&gpio0 26 (GPIO_ACTIVE_HIGH | GPIO_PULL_DOWN)> // LH ROW1
, <&gpio0 5 (GPIO_ACTIVE_HIGH | GPIO_PULL_DOWN)> // LH ROW2
, <&gpio0 6 (GPIO_ACTIVE_HIGH | GPIO_PULL_DOWN)> // LH ROW3
, <&gpio0 8 (GPIO_ACTIVE_HIGH | GPIO_PULL_DOWN)> // LH ROW4
, <&gpio0 7 (GPIO_ACTIVE_HIGH | GPIO_PULL_DOWN)> // LH ROW5
, <&gpio1 9 (GPIO_ACTIVE_HIGH | GPIO_PULL_DOWN)> // LH ROW6
;
col-gpios
= <&gpio1 8 GPIO_ACTIVE_HIGH> // LH COL6
, <&gpio1 4 GPIO_ACTIVE_HIGH> // LH COL5
, <&gpio1 6 GPIO_ACTIVE_HIGH> // LH COL4
, <&gpio1 7 GPIO_ACTIVE_HIGH> // LH COL3
, <&gpio1 5 GPIO_ACTIVE_HIGH> // LH COL2
, <&gpio1 3 GPIO_ACTIVE_HIGH> // LH COL1
, <&gpio1 1 GPIO_ACTIVE_HIGH> // LH Thumb
;
};
